Miclxin (DS37262926) is a potent inhibitor of mutant β-catenin , involving in Wnt signaling pathway. Miclxin induces β-catenin-dependent apoptosis , leads to severe mitochondrial damage with the loss of mitochondrial membrane. Miclxin kills tumor via targeting to MIC60 , a major components of the mitochondrial contact site and cristae organizing system (MICOS) complex. In Vitro Miclxin (0-15 μM; 48 h) inhibits the growth of β-catenin-mutated HCT116 cells and isogenic HCT116 (CTNNB1 Δ45/-) cells, and induces (10 μM; 24 h) apoptosis in HCT116 cells. Cell Viability AssayCell Line: HCT116 (CTNNB1 +/–) and (CTNNB1 △45/–) Concentration: 0, 5, 8, 10, 12, and 15 μM Incubation Time: 48 hours Result: Inhibited cell growth with inhibition rate of 100% at 15 μM.
